Vegetable Stir-Fry
A mix of fresh vegetables sautéed with soy sauce and spices, served over rice or noodles. This is a quick and healthy meal perfect for busy nights.
Instructions
-
Step 1
Put the rinsed rice and water in the saucepan. Bring to a boil over medium-high heat, reduce to low, and cook for 18 minutes until the water is absorbed and the rice is tender.
-
Step 2
Heat the vegetable oil in the skillet over medium-high heat. Add the onion, garlic, and ginger, then stir with the spatula for 3 minutes until fragrant and the onion begins to soften.
-
Step 3
Add the broccoli, carrot, and bell pepper to the skillet. Stir-fry with the spatula for 7 minutes until the vegetables are brightly colored and tender-crisp, allowing the large load to soften and steam.
-
Step 4
Pour the soy sauce over the vegetables and toss with the spatula for 2 minutes until everything is glossy and evenly coated.
-
Step 5
Serve the tender rice from the saucepan and top it with the hot vegetable stir-fry from the skillet.
